C6 Cooler Lines

What are the threaded hole sizes for the two cooler lines going into the C6 transmission body? My online research says it could be 1/4” or 1/8” NPT. Some also claim the threads could be NPS(which I doubt).


Second, how much fluid will you loose when removing the tubes from the transmission body? Do I need plugs handy to stop the flow?

Its not gonna leak to much outa there,but what is in the lines. But anyways,Do you mean the threaded fittng on the tube or the adaptor fitting between the tube & trans case. The tubing is 5/16",so you would need a male plug for inverted flare..If you remove the adaptor,you can use a 1/4"pipe plug. But I wouldn't worry to much bout it either way,cuz your not gonna lose to much.

on my 72 c4 and my 78 c6 they both were 1/8 npt. you'll loose as much out the lines, as the trans just put a drain pan under it, it wont be more than a quart.
